服務(wù)器日志是管理和監(jiān)控服務(wù)器的關(guān)鍵工具,它提供了有關(guān)系統(tǒng)運(yùn)行狀況、錯(cuò)誤和安全事件的寶貴信息消息。本文將介紹如何查看服務(wù)器日志的不同方法,包括使用命令行工具和日志管理工具。我們還將探索服務(wù)器日志的重要特性,以及如何有效地分析和解讀日志信息,以方便改進(jìn)服務(wù)器性能和確保系統(tǒng)的安全性。
一、介紹服務(wù)器日志的定義及其重要性質(zhì)
服務(wù)器操作系統(tǒng)、應(yīng)用程序和服務(wù)所產(chǎn)生的記錄文件,用于記錄系統(tǒng)的活動(dòng)和事件。包含了豐富的信息,如系統(tǒng)啟動(dòng)、錯(cuò)誤報(bào)告、網(wǎng)絡(luò)請(qǐng)求、用戶訪問(wèn)等。通過(guò)查看服務(wù)器日志,管理員可以快速了解別問(wèn)題、進(jìn)行故障排除,并優(yōu)化服務(wù)器性能。此外,日志還可以用于監(jiān)控系統(tǒng)的安全性,檢測(cè)可能在的安全威嚇。
二、經(jīng)常看到的服務(wù)器日志 在開(kāi)始查看服務(wù)器日志之前,讓我們先了解幾種經(jīng)常看到的服務(wù)器日志類型:
- 訪問(wèn)日志:記錄使用用戶對(duì)服務(wù)器資源的訪問(wèn)請(qǐng)求,如網(wǎng)站訪問(wèn)日志、API請(qǐng)求日志等。
- 錯(cuò)誤日志:記錄系統(tǒng)和應(yīng)用程序發(fā)生的錯(cuò)誤,包括崩潰、異常和警告信息。
- 安全日志:記錄系統(tǒng)的安全事件,如登錄嘗試、訪問(wèn)拒絕、惡意攻擊等。
- 系統(tǒng)日志:記錄操作系統(tǒng)的活動(dòng)和事件,如系統(tǒng)啟動(dòng)、關(guān)機(jī)、服務(wù)狀態(tài)等。
三、命令行工具查看服務(wù)器日志
- Linux 系統(tǒng) a. 使用尾命令:尾命令用于顯示文件末尾的內(nèi)容,常用于實(shí)時(shí)查看日志文件的更新信息。使用grep命令:grep命令用于在文件中搜索指定的模式或關(guān)鍵字,可用于過(guò)濾日志中的特定內(nèi)容。使用less指令:less指令可點(diǎn)擊查看文件內(nèi)容,并支持搜索、滾動(dòng)和跳轉(zhuǎn)至指定行號(hào)。
- Windows 系統(tǒng) a. 使用事件查看器:事件查看器是Windows系統(tǒng)自帶的的日志管理工具,它提供了一個(gè)圖形界面來(lái)查看和管理各種系統(tǒng)日志和應(yīng)用程序日志。管理人員可以通過(guò)Event Viewer瀏覽不同的日志類型,并使用濾器和搜索功能來(lái)篩選和查找特定事件。 b. 使用PowerShell:PowerShell是Windows系統(tǒng)的強(qiáng)大命令工具,可以使用它來(lái)查看和分析服務(wù)器日志。管理員可以使用Get-EventLog命令獲取特定事件日志的內(nèi)容,以及使用Select-String命令來(lái)搜索關(guān)鍵字或模式。
四、日志管理工具查看服務(wù)器日志
除了命令行工具,還有一些專門的日志管理工具可用于查看和分析服務(wù)器日志。以下是幾個(gè)常用的工具:
- ELK Stack:ELK Stack是一個(gè)開(kāi)源的日志管理平臺(tái),它由Elasticsearch、Logstash和Kibana三個(gè)組件組成。管理員可以使用Logstash將日志數(shù)據(jù)收集并處理到E lasticsearch中,然后使用Kibana進(jìn)行可視化和分析。
- Splunk:Splunk是一個(gè)流行的商業(yè)日志管理和分析工具。它提供了強(qiáng)大的搜索和查詢功能,以及可視化儀表板和報(bào)告,幫助管理人員更好地理解和利用日志數(shù)據(jù)。
- Graylog:Graylog是另一個(gè)開(kāi)源的日志管理平臺(tái),它具有類似于ELK Stack的功能,提供了日志收集、存儲(chǔ)、搜索和分析的能力。
五、服務(wù)器日志的重要特性。
服務(wù)器日志對(duì)于管理和監(jiān)控服務(wù)器至關(guān)重要,它們具有以下重要特性:
- 故障排除和調(diào)試:通過(guò)查看服務(wù)器日志,管理人員可以追蹤和分析系統(tǒng)中的錯(cuò)誤和異常情況,以方便及時(shí)進(jìn)行故障排除和修復(fù)。
- 性能分析和優(yōu)化:服務(wù)器日志可以提供有關(guān)系統(tǒng)資源使用情況、響應(yīng)時(shí)間和吞吐量的信息,通過(guò)分析日志,管理人員可以識(shí)別性能力瓶頸,并進(jìn)行優(yōu)化。
- 安全事件監(jiān)控和響應(yīng):服務(wù)器日志中記錄了安全事件的詳細(xì)信息,管理人員可以通過(guò)監(jiān)控日志來(lái)檢測(cè)潛在的安全威脅,并采取適當(dāng)?shù)姆磻?yīng)施施。
六、有效分析和解讀服務(wù)器日志
要有效率分析和解析服務(wù)器日志,以下是幾個(gè)關(guān)鍵步驟:
- 確定關(guān)鍵指標(biāo):根據(jù)需要和目標(biāo),確定需要注意和監(jiān)測(cè)的關(guān)鍵指標(biāo),如錯(cuò)誤率、響應(yīng)時(shí)間等。
- 使用:根據(jù):根據(jù)特定,使用特定的,搜索正或則表達(dá)式
- 制定適當(dāng)?shù)膱?bào)警和通知機(jī)制:根據(jù)日志中的異常事件或關(guān)鍵指標(biāo)的變化,設(shè)置報(bào)警和通知機(jī)制,及時(shí)獲得系狀態(tài)的變化。
七、總結(jié)
本文將詳細(xì)介紹不同操作系統(tǒng)下載使用指令行工具和日志管理工具查看服務(wù)器日志的方法。此外,我們還將加強(qiáng)調(diào)服務(wù)器日志的重要特性,并提供有效的分析和解讀策略。通過(guò)深入了解了調(diào)服務(wù)器日志的內(nèi)容和使用方法,讀者將能夠更好地管理和監(jiān)控服務(wù)器,并提供高度系統(tǒng)的穩(wěn)定性、性能和安全性。
(注:本篇文章所提到的命令行工具和日志管理工具僅作為示例,讀者可根據(jù)實(shí)際需要選擇合適的工具進(jìn)行操作。)